Synopsis

Product Description
The Raybeats went into Green St. Recording on June 4, 1982 with Philip Glass, Michael Riesman, and Kurt Munkacsi without really knowing what to expect. We wouldn t know what we had until thirty years later. So begins the liner notes to THE RAYBEATS THE LOST PHILIP GLASS SESSIONS, a set of seven songs made in the early 1980s by the instrumental rock band The Raybeats that featured keyboard arrangements by Philip Glass. New York City in the late-1970s and early 1980s was a place where the cross pollination of very different artistic streams was limitless. These never-heard-before tracks were recently discovered by The Raybeats themselves: Don Christensen, Jody Harris, and Pat Irwin. Three of the tracks featured arrangements by Glass, performed by Glass, Michael Riesman, and the production team of Glass, Riesman, Kurt Munkacsi, and The Raybeats. The songs include Black Beach, And I Do Just What I Want, Pack of Camels, Hoodlum Priest, A Sad Little Caper, 1.2 Girls, and a cover of the classic Jack the Ripper.
